Macro de sélection d'une valeur donnée dans un filtre

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

gomaub

XLDnaute Nouveau
Bonsoir,

J'ai enregistré une macro qui a pour objectif de n'afficher que les valeurs "VRAI par rapport à un filtre posé sur une plage de cellules.

Lorsque je le fais manuellement les valeurs "VRAI" sont bien affichées, par contre quand je fais tourner la macro
(ActiveSheet.Range("$A$3:$D$9").AutoFilter Field:=4, Criteria1:="VRAI")
l'ensemble des cellules comprises dans le filtre se masquent.

Si une âme généreuse a la solution ça serait du tonerre.

Merci

Gomaub

PS: j'ai joint le fichier avec la macro
 

Pièces jointes

Re : Macro de sélection d'une valeur donnée dans un filtre

Bonsoir

Dans la macro essayes

ActiveSheet.Range("$A$3:$D$9").AutoFilter Field:=4, Criteria1:=True

En gardant ta formule dans ta macro
ActiveSheet.Range("$A$3:$D$9").AutoFilter Field:=4, Criteria1:="VRAI"
Il faudrait modifier tes formules dans le tableur comme ceci
=SI(SOMME.CARRES(A4:C4)<>0=VRAI;"VRAI";"FAUX")
 
Dernière édition:
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
7
Affichages
3 K
Compte Supprimé 979
C
Réponses
14
Affichages
2 K
Retour